Установка
В данном разделе описан порядок установки ПО АвтоГРАФ.WEB на операционные системы MS Windows:
- Установка Microsoft SQL Server.
- Установка нового экземпляра ПО АвтоГРАФ.WEB.
- Настройка рабочего порта.
После установки ПО АвтоГРАФ.WEB убедитесь, что в параметрах операционной системы MS Windows выбран формат региона «Русский (Россия)», соответствующий локали ru-RU
.
Установка Microsoft SQL Server
Для работы ПО АвтоГРАФ.WEB требуется база данных. Для создания базы необходимо установить базу данных MS SQL Server. Программа АвтоГРАФ.WEB совместима с MS SQL Server версий 2019 и выше. Рекомендуется всегда использовать актуальную версию программы.
Далее рассматривается установка экземпляра баз данных на примере SQL Server 2019.
Порядок установки:
- Загрузите файл установки MS SQL Server и начните установку.
- В окне «Центр установки SQL Server» выберите «Новая установка изолированного экземпляра SQL Server или добавление компонентов к существующей установке». Подготовка к установке занимает некоторое время, дождитесь завершения операции.
- Далее программа установки предложит ознакомиться с условиями лицензионного соглашения на программное обеспечение Microsoft. Внимательно изучите соглашение, и, если вы согласны с его условиями, выберите опцию «Я принимаю условия лицензионного соглашения», затем нажмите «Далее». Если вы не согласны с условиями лицензионного соглашения, нажмите «Отмена» и прервите установку MS SQL Server. Без установки экземпляра SQL Server дальнейшая установка ПО АвтоГРАФ.WEB невозможна.
- Выберите компоненты Express для установки.
- Задайте имя экземпляра SQL Server, как показано на рисунке. Идентификатор экземпляра и именованный экземпляр могут быть произвольными. Если на вашем компьютере уже установлена база данных, то имя и идентификатор экземпляра новой базы не должны совпадать с параметрами существующей базы данных.
- В разделе «Конфигурация сервера» перейдите на вкладку «Параметры сортировки» и установите настройки, как показано на рисунке ниже.
- Настройте режим аутентификации администраторов: выберите смешанный режим и задай те пароль администратора. При создании базы данных, после установки web-сервера используются логин SA и пароль, заданные в этом меню. Поэтому рекомендуется запомнить введенный пароль.
предупреждение
Пароль администратора базы данных должен содержать заглавные и строчные буквы, цифры и символы. Если заданный пароль не удовлетворяет установленному формату, то при попытке перейти к следующему шагу установки SQL Server Express появится уведомление о недопустимом пароле.
- Продолжите установку SQL Server с выбранными настройками. Дождитесь окончания установки. Затем перейдите к следующему шагу установки ПО АвтоГРАФ.WEB.
Установка ПО АвтоГРАФ.WEB
Загрузка и распаковка файлов
- Загрузите установочные файлы ПО АвтоГРАФ.WEB с официального форума ООО «ТехноКом» или по ссылке, отправленной на электронную почту.
- Распакуйте все файлы в папку на локальном диске, например,
C:\WebMapCore
.
Создание базы данных
- Запустите командную строку и выполните следующую команду из папки, в которую была распакована программа АвтоГРАФ.WEB (например,
C:\WebMapCore
):
WebMapCore.exe createdb -s (LOCAL) -t 0 -d AGNET_777 -u sa
где:
AGNET_777 — название новой базы данных АвтоГРАФ.WEB,
sa — стандартный логин системного администратора MS SQL, пароль будет запрош ен.
- После запроса
Enter 'sa' password
введите пароль системного администратора базы данных, заданный при установке Microsoft SQL Server. Вводимые символы не отображаются в командной строке. НажмитеEnter
после ввода пароля. - Дождитесь завершения установки — отобразится сообщение SUCCESSFULLY COMPLETED.
После выполнения команды будет создана база данных и в файл appsettings.user.json
будет добавлена строка подключения к этой базе данных (connection-string
).
Установка и запуск сервиса
- Запустите командную строку от имени администратора.
- Выполните следующую команду:
sc create WebMapCore binPath=C:\WebMapCore\WebMapCore.exe
- Выполните следующую команду для запуска WebMapCore как сервиса:
net start WebMapCore
Если сервис не запускается, то проверьте журнал событий Windows (Event log) и файлы логов в подкаталоге C:\WebMapCore\Logs
. Для диагностических целей сервис WebMapCore.exe
может быть запущен из консоли.
Настройка рабочего порта
ПО АвтоГРАФ.WEB по умолчанию устанавливается на порт 5000. При необходимости установите альтернативный порт для ПО АвтоГРАФ.WEB:
- В режиме работы «Сервис» порт задается в файле
appsettings.json
.
- Для использования HTTPS-порта (443) требуется сертификат в виде
.PFX
, путь к которому должен быть указан в файлеappsettings.json
, в секцииKestrel
. Пример приведен на рисунке ниже:
- После установки порта перейдите к настройке подключения к серверу АвтоГРАФ для доступа к цифровому лицензионному ключу.
До настройки подключения к серверу АвтоГРАФ рекомендуется выполнить настройку обратного прокси сервера, а также установить и настроить службу DataLoaderService, если необходимо.
Инструкция по настройке обратного прокси сервера приведена в следующем разделе.
Инструкция по установке и настройке службы DataLoaderService для ОС MS Windows приведена в разделе Настройка DataLoaderService.